Crowns
They are common alternatives for teeth that are cracked or decaying. Crowns will envelop your entire tooth, making it appear full and its native size.
Dentures & Partial Dentures
Dentures are a removable plate that contains one or more false teeth. They have a gum-colored base that you place on your gums in order for the piece to look natural. Dentures can be beneficial to your health by making it easier to eat and speak.
Crown Lengthening
This procedure is done when a tooth needs fixing. In some cases, the tooth is not long enough to support crowns and fillings, your dentist will remove gum tissue to expose more of the tooth.
Inlays and Onlays
Their purpose is to mend or strengthen a tooth. They can also be used as replacements for old fillings or crowns. An inlay is a common and easy way to replace an old filling. It is similar to a filling and fits inside the cusp of the tooth. Onlays are more extensive and will cover the entire top of the tooth.
Bridges
Dental bridges are used to replace missing teeth. They work by connecting to the teeth on either side of the bridge. Bridges are known for their durability and ability to be long lasting.
